Everton
Everton were unable to produce any surprises against Arsenal in their last match, losing 0:2 away to the league leaders. As a result, their just-started two-game winning run in the league came to an end. Moreover, the team failed to score for only the second time in their last 12 Premier League matches. Even so, Everton have remained eighth in the standings and are still among the contenders to finish not only in the European places, but even in the top five, which they trail by seven points. It is also worth adding that matches involving the club remain among the lowest-scoring in the league, with an average of 2.3 goals.
- Exactly two or three goals were scored in six of the Liverpool-based club's previous eight league matches.
- Everton have avoided defeat in seven of their last 10 Premier League games (four wins and three draws).
- The team have failed to win six of their previous seven home Premier League matches (two draws and four defeats).

Chelsea
Chelsea are not in great shape. In the last round, the club suffered their second defeat in the last three league matches, losing 0:1 at home to Newcastle. Chelsea have managed just one win in their previous five Premier League games (two draws and two defeats). In addition, their long 14-match scoring run in the Premier League came to an end. The team have dropped to sixth, sitting three points off the top four and just one point behind fifth-placed Liverpool. We should also note that the Londoners have the fourth-best attack in the league, with 53 goals.
- The team have avoided defeat in seven of their previous nine Premier League matches (five wins and two draws).
- Both teams scored in 12 of Chelsea's last 14 league matches.
- At least three goals were scored in six of the previous eight Premier League games.

Everton vs Chelsea: Match Prediction
The London club are clearly not themselves. They are on a three-game losing run, although two of those defeats came in the Champions League, but both were very painful and heavy losses. At the same time, the team can now fully focus on the Premier League, where problems have also emerged. If Chelsea do not improve, they could spend next season in the Europa League or even the Europa Conference League, which would be a loss — first and foremost financially. So we expect the Londoners to raise their level for this match.
No matter how the game ends, we would suggest that the hosts will find it difficult to show much in attack. The home side consistently score few goals, and even at their own ground in the previous five league matches they managed to score more than once only against Burnley. Chelsea may concede often away from home, but it rarely reaches two or more goals conceded. In addition, in four consecutive head-to-head Premier League meetings, Everton have been unable to score against Chelsea — losing three times and drawing once.
